Scope of Application:
This UV accelerated aging test chamber uses imported UVA-340 fluorescent ultraviolet lamps as the light source to simulate damage caused by sunlight, rain, and dew. The UV weathering chamber utilizes fluorescent UV lamps to simulate the effects of solar radiation and condensation moisture to simulate dew formation.Test specimens are placed in a controlled environment where light exposure and moisture alternate in cyclic programs at a specified temperature, enabling accelerated weathering tests to evaluate material durability. The UV test chamber can reproduce damage that would normally occur outdoors over months or years within just a few days or weeks.Typical types of damage include fading, discoloration, loss of gloss, chalking, cracking, hazing, blistering, embrittlement, strength degradation, aging, and oxidation.
Product Overview:
This UV accelerated aging test chamber can simulate environmental conditions found in natural climates, including ultraviolet radiation, rainfall, high temperature, high humidity, condensation, and darkness. By reproducing these conditions and combining them into a programmed cycle, the chamber automatically performs repeated test cycles, which represents the working principle of the UV aging test chamber.During the testing process, the equipment automatically monitors the black panel temperature and water tank temperature. With an optional irradiance measurement and control system, the light irradiance can be measured and regulated to remain stable at 0.76 W/m² at 340 nm or at a user-specified set value, significantly extending the service life of the lamps.The chamber is also equipped with a spray system.
Complies with International Standards:
ASTM G153, ASTM G154, ASTM D4329, ASTM D4799, ASTM D4587, SAE J2020, ISO 4892, and all current UV aging test standards.
